OBJECTIVES AND CONTENTS

Objectives of the Course Unit: The aim of the course is to inform about the museums, the features of monuments and periods and to create a consciousness of protection of historical monuments.
Contents of the Course Unit: This course includes: The importance of the museum, functions, to protect the antiquities and exhibited rules, historical process of Turkish museology, museums and exhibited monuments in the World and Turkey.

KEY LEARNING OUTCOMES OF THE COURSE UNIT (On successful completion of this course unit, students/learners will or will be able to)

Define museum and museology.
List the functions of museums.
Classify museums according to their types.
Interpret historical monuments in Turkey and the World.
Compare the characteristics of museums in Turkey and the World.
